Parašė Exz0sT·  2009 Bir. 15 21:06:05
#3
if ($settings['maintenance'] != "1") {
	$cond = ($userdata['user_level'] != 0 ? "'".$userdata['user_id']."'" : "'0' AND online_ip='".USER_IP."'");
	$result = dbquery("SELECT * FROM ".$db_prefix."online WHERE online_user=".$cond."");
	if (dbrows($result) != 0) {
		$result = dbquery("UPDATE ".$db_prefix."online SET online_lastactive='".time()."' WHERE online_user=".$cond."");
	} else {
		$name = ($userdata['user_level'] != 0 ? $userdata['user_id'] : "0");
		$result = dbquery("INSERT INTO ".$db_prefix."online VALUES('$name', '".USER_IP."', '".time()."')");
	}
	$result = dbquery("DELETE FROM ".$db_prefix."online WHERE online_lastactive<".(time()-60)."");
	$result = dbquery("SELECT * FROM ".$db_prefix."online WHERE online_user='0'");
	$result = dbquery(
		"SELECT ton.*, user_id,user_name FROM ".$db_prefix."online ton
		LEFT JOIN ".$db_prefix."users tu ON ton.online_user=tu.user_id
		WHERE online_user!='1'"
	);
	}
echo "".dbrows($result)."";